Eugene Ballet's Alice in Wonderland

Alice tumbles down the rabbit hole in this imaginative ballet filled with humor, wonder, and unforgettable characters. Created by Toni Pimble, Alice in Wonderland brings Lewis Carroll’s beloved story to life through playful choreography, whimsical design, and vivid stagecraft. Flowing silk fabrics transform into the Pool of Tears, curious creatures appear at every turn, and Wonderland unfolds through the eyes of a curious child.

Narrated live by Bill Hulings as Lewis Carroll, the performance helps guide audiences through the story, making it especially welcoming for children and families experiencing ballet for the first time.

The program also includes The Large Rock and The Little Yew by Suzanne Haag, a poetic ballet inspired by a story by local author Gregory Ahlijian about a tiny seed that grows against all odds.

Together, these two works create an imaginative and heartfelt program celebrating curiosity, resilience, and the unique perspective of childhood.
